The Film Crew Technician Program certificate is designed as a two-term 24-credit cohort program. The first course will give the student an overview of the movie industry while affording an opportunity for hands-on experience via the production of various projects. During the second term the student will develop a specialization in one of the “below the line” craft areas. Topics covered will include: film production and procedures, film crew organization and job descriptions,film production safety issues, scripts and script breakdown, pre-production, production shooting,post-production/editing, art crafts, grip/electric crafts, camera, sound, makeup/hair/wardrobe and production office.
